How flexible injection is made

The flexible injection we are talking about has been made by the scientists of South Korea's Advanced Institute of Science and Technology. It has been claimed that this injection does not cause any kind of pain.

How does this injection work?

According to the scientists of South Korea's Advanced Institute of Science and Technology, this injection has been prepared from a chemical called gallium. And for the same reason when it is applied in your body, you will not feel any pain. Scientists say, when the injection goes into your body, it becomes completely soft and flexible. So you will not feel any pain or swelling after the injection.
